WebMay 2, 2024 · Dry mouth, drowsiness, headache, fatigue, dizziness on standing, dry eyes, and constipation. Clonidine may lower blood pressure and increase the risk of falls when going from a lying or sitting position to standing. Drowsiness caused by clonidine may affect a person's ability to drive or operate machinery. WebOct 26, 2024 · Guanfacine also dose this, but less so. Both drugs should be stopped gradually, lowering the dose by 1mg for guanfacine or 0.1 mg for clonidine every 3-7 days. And hypertension is not the only withdrawal symptom – patients can experience headaches, racing heart, nausea, flushing, hot flases, lightheadness, and anxiety.
